[英]Unable to do RSA Encryption/Decryption using Crypto++ (isValidCoding is false)
[英]I'm using Crypto++ for RSA encryption. My plain text exceeds FixedMaxPlaintextLength. What should I do?
我应该把文字分成几块吗?
RSA是错误的加密方案吗?
错误的计划。 消息加密的标准技术(例如,PGP和CMS)是为AES之类的东西生成随机对称会话密钥K,并使用密钥K使用AES对消息进行加密。然后使用消息的每个接收者的公钥加密K. 。
通常,非对称RSA算法用于密钥交换。 如果要加密更大的数据块,最好使用AES之类的东西。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.